The "error in file length setting"  concerns large containers on external USB-connected drives and  is proved to be hardware-related problem.
Please direct you attention to the USB disk itself, to USB card and USB connection you are using. 

Additionally, there are several possible workarounds:

1) Create several smaller containers instead of the single large one.

2) Create Dynamic container (for NTFS-formatted drives)

3) Create container with 'Randomize disk space in the background' option (for NTFS-formatted drives) .
4) Use BestCrypt Volume Encryption software to encrypt the whole disk.

